在现代企业网络架构中,虚拟私人网络(VPN)已成为远程办公、分支机构互联和云服务访问的核心技术,当多个VPN连接同时接入同一局域网时,一个常见但棘手的问题——“网段冲突”便可能出现,作为一名网络工程师,我曾多次遇到因IP地址重叠导致用户无法访问内部资源、设备通信中断甚至整个子网瘫痪的情况,本文将从原理出发,结合实际案例,详细解析如何识别、定位并彻底解决VPN网段冲突问题。
什么是网段冲突?当两个或多个网络(如本地内网与远程VPN客户端分配的网段)使用了相同的IP地址范围时,就会发生冲突,公司内网使用192.168.1.0/24,而某个远程用户通过OpenVPN连接时被分配了同样的子网,那么该用户的流量可能无法正确路由到目标服务器,反而被本地路由器误判为本地广播包处理,造成通信失败。
常见的引发原因包括:
- 配置不规范:管理员未对各分支机构或远程用户分配独立且唯一的私有IP段。
- 默认设置重复:某些VPN软件(如Cisco AnyConnect、OpenVPN)默认使用10.8.0.0/24等常用网段,若未手动调整,极易与其他网络冲突。
- 动态DHCP分配干扰:若本地DHCP服务器与远程客户端IP池重叠,会导致主机获取到冲突IP地址,进而引发网络异常。
我的一次实战经验是在某制造业客户现场:他们部署了多台工业PLC设备,通过站点到站点VPN连接总部,由于所有远程工厂都使用默认的10.0.0.0/24作为客户端网段,导致部分工厂无法访问总部数据库,解决方案如下:
第一步:排查与诊断
- 使用
ipconfig /all(Windows)或ifconfig(Linux)查看客户端分配的IP; - 用
traceroute或ping测试到目标服务器的连通性; - 在防火墙或路由器上启用日志功能,捕捉异常ARP请求或ICMP错误。
第二步:修改网段配置
- 登录到VPN服务器(如OpenVPN配置文件),修改
server指令为非冲突网段,例如改为172.16.0.0/24; - 若使用Cisco ASA或FortiGate,需在“Remote Access”策略中指定不同的“Client Address Pool”。
第三步:同步更新客户端配置
- 将新的网段信息推送给所有远程用户,并更新其客户端配置文件;
- 对于移动办公用户,建议使用自动推送机制(如通过Tunnelblick或Cisco AnyConnect Client)。
第四步:验证与监控
- 部署Ping脚本定时检测关键节点可达性;
- 使用Wireshark抓包分析是否有重复ARP响应或ICMP重定向消息。
我们成功解决了冲突,工厂恢复稳定访问,这提醒我们:在设计网络时,必须提前规划IP地址空间,避免“拿来主义”,合理划分VLAN、使用不同子网、启用DHCP隔离等手段,是预防此类问题的根本之道。
网段冲突虽小,影响巨大,作为网络工程师,我们要以严谨的态度、系统的方法和持续的优化意识,确保每一处细节都能支撑起企业的数字化运转。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速


